Scoutmaster James Wall of Troop 973, shown here with Rochelle Smalls, district executive for the Yellow River District, was recently honored for his 40 years as a Scout leader. Wall earned his Eagle Scout Award two weeks after his 14th birthday, and has dedicated his life to mentoring young men. Wall also presented Joshua Schindler with his Eagle Scout Award, Wall's 30th Eagle Scout, a milestone for Scoutmasters. The Atlanta Area Council of the Boy Scouts presented Wall with a Certificate of Merit Award recognizing his dedication and service. Wall's Troop 973 meets at First Baptist Church of Conyers each Thursday evening.
